Why Buyers Need a Benchmark Rather Than a Brochure

Electric actuators are not generic motors. A buyer must match torque, operating speed, control mode, duty cycle, mounting flange, enclosure rating, temperature range, and hazardous-area certification to a specific valve and site. Many suppliers use similar language: IP67, On-Off or Modulating, explosion-proof, intelligent control. The real question is which supplier can document those claims across a usable range of models.

Technical Explanation: What the Specifications Mean for Procurement

For buyers, the key issue is not whether a datasheet exists, but whether the datasheet parameters can be matched to the duty profile of the plant.

Control method. CHENGLEI models are described as On-Off or Modulating. On-Off actuators are used when a valve only needs to open or close. Modulating actuators are needed when a control system continuously adjusts the valve position, typically using a 4-20mA signal. The published specification for the ZXC Type Electric Rotary Actuator also lists position feedback options of 4-20mA and 0-10VDC.

Motor duty cycle. Several CHENGLEI actuators list a 10-minute short-time working system, while the high-torque quarter-turn configuration supports S2 10/15/30 minutes or S1/S3/S4/S6 duty classes at 24 or 40 percent. A buyer should check duty class before selecting an actuator for frequent modulating service. A short-time rated actuator is generally intended for intermittent valve movement, not continuous modulation.

Protection grade and environment. IP65, IP67, and IP68 all appear across CHENGLEI specifications. IP67 is common for the multi-turn Z-series; the DQ series and the high-torque quarter-turn model list IP65/IP67/IP68. Many products also list F-class insulation and an ambient temperature range of -20°C to +60°C. The DQ series extends that range to -60°C to +70°C, which matters for cold-climate and outdoor installations.

Explosion-proof classification. The product documentation cites ATEX/Exd BT4/CT4 on several models. In practice, the BT4 and CT4 notation refers to gas groups and temperature classes used in hazardous-area classification. Buyers should compare the actuator rating with the site’s hazardous-area schedule and the applicable IEC 60079 framework for flameproof enclosures.

Connection and mounting. CHENGLEI lists mounting standards such as ISO 5211, ISO 5210, and JB2920 depending on model. Flange numbers such as F05/F07, F10, F12, F14, and F16 appear across the multi-turn and part-turn families. The high-torque quarter-turn model is described with JB2920 torque-type or ISO5210 (GB/T 12222) thrust-flange connection. This level of mounting detail is important because an actuator must physically fit the valve without custom adapter work.

Body materials. Material options include iron, aluminum alloy, stainless steel, and carbon steel, depending on the model and specification. For corrosive or offshore environments, material selection is part of the enclosure and lifetime strategy, not only a mechanical detail.

Comparison With Traditional Actuation Approaches

Electric actuators are often selected as replacements for manual valves or as an alternative to pneumatic actuation. Manual operation remains appropriate for valves that are rarely operated or where no control signal is available. Pneumatic actuation is common in process plants that already have a clean compressed-air supply and prefer air-powered fail-safe action.

CHENGLEI electric actuators bring a different set of characteristics. They respond directly to electrical control signals, which simplifies integration with PLC and DCS systems. Position feedback can be provided in standard analog forms such as 4-20mA or 0-10VDC. Some models include a manual override handwheel, battery backup, or Bluetooth connection, which are useful during commissioning, emergency operation, and routine maintenance.

The practical boundary of electric actuation is power availability. If a site has no reliable electricity supply but has compressed air, pneumatic actuation may still be the more reasonable choice. In explosive atmospheres, an electric actuator must carry the correct hazardous-area certification; CHENGLEI lists ATEX/Exd BT4/CT4 for several models, but the buyer must confirm that the certification matches the specific gas group, temperature class, and area classification of the installation.

Market Trend Analysis

The market trend data supports continued attention to electric actuators. The global electric actuator market is estimated to be around USD 11.5 billion in 2024, with a projected CAGR of 6.5 to 7.2 percent through 2034. Asia Pacific accounted for approximately 38.5 percent of electric valve actuator revenue in 2025, and China’s export value for electric motor parts, including actuator components, reached about USD 6.43 billion in 2024, representing an estimated 26.1 percent of global exports (OEC).

Demand signals also point toward smarter products. Industry analysis describes a shift toward Industrial Ethernet protocols such as Profinet and EtherNet/IP, plus 5G edge connectivity for digital twin integration. Buyers should therefore look beyond basic motor-and-gearbox specifications and evaluate how an actuator will connect to modern control networks. Bluetooth-enabled setups, battery backup, and position feedback options, such as those listed on several CHENGLEI models, are consistent with this direction.

Standards also matter. Explosion-proof electric actuators are classified under IEC 60079-0 for general requirements and IEC 60079-1 for flameproof enclosures, with gas groups and temperature classes used to select equipment for the correct hazardous area. For CHENGLEI, the BT4/CT4 markings and the Ex d IIB T4 references in the application documentation should be checked against the buyer’s site classification.
